Basic facts about this digital color

The digital color #A0CAB5 is classified in the Register under the Spring Green Color Family, with Mild Saturation and Very Light brightness. In numbers: rgb(160, 202, 181) (62.7% red, 79.2% green, 71% blue), or CMYK 16 / 0 / 8 / 21 for print. Curious how these numbers work? Read our RGB color codes guide.

The color #A0CAB5 reads as a mildly saturated spring green and has a delicate, washed-out lightness. Expect to see shades like this in airy backdrops, whitespace-heavy designs and gentle gradients. In The Official Register of Color Names it is practically indistinguishable from McCrorey Green (#A8CBB0). Slightly further away sit Shadow Green (#9AC0B6) and Turquoise Green (#A0D6B4).

Technically, the mix leans on its green channel (rgb(160, 202, 181)), which gives #A0CAB5 its character. On this background, black text reaches a 11.6:1 contrast ratio (passing WCAG AAA); white stays at 1.8:1. #A0CAB5 has no official name yet. #A0CAB5 color harmonies

Color harmonies are pleasing color schemes created according to their position on a color wheel.

Complementary

Complementary color schemes are made by picking two opposite colors con the color wheel. They appear vibrant near to each other.

Complementary color schemes

Split complementary

Split complementary schemes are like complementary but they uses two adiacent colors of the complement. They are more flexible than complementary ones.

Split complementary color scheme

Analogous

Analogous color schemes are made by picking three colors that are next to each other on the color wheel. They are perceived as calm and serene.

Analogous color scheme

Triadic

Triadic color schemes are created by picking three colors equally spaced on the color wheel. They appear quite contrasted and multicolored.

Triadic color scheme

Tetradic

Tetradic color schemes are made form two couples of complementary colors in a rectangular shape on the color wheel.

Tetradic color scheme

Square

Square color schemes are like tetradic arranged in a square instead of rectangle. Colors appear even more contrasting.
